What Does Final Expense Insurance Insure?
Burial insurance covers your funeral expenses as you could have guessed from the name. This includes obvious things like buying your final resting place, buying the coffin (or cremation prices), paying for your funeral service, and buying a headstone.
Other lesser known prices that can frequently be covered are things like grave digging and floral arrangements. They can add up quickly, although they’re not substantial on their own.
For an unprepared family who might not have a lot of disposable income, these costs (which can run into the tens of tens of thousands of dollars) can be a significant jolt. Many families turn to banks to get loans, being in debt to pay the funeral expenses of a loved one isn’t a pleasant feeling off. Particularly when you’re trying to grieve.
How Much Final Expense Insurance Cost?
So as we expect you may concur by now, protecting your family from these sudden and significant costs is a thing that should be considered near essential. When” not “if” death is inevitable, it is very much a case of “.
Costs for burial insurance plans differ radically between suppliers. Some basic coverage strategies can begin from just a few dollars a week, but there are exceptionally comprehensive strategies that cost more.
However as you can imagine, better coverage requires fees that are higher.
Most payments are made monthly, however there are a few plans that accept weekly payments also.
The sum you should pay is primarily decided by your age. The old you’re, the more your premiums will be. If you are statistically closer to death, you are likely to have to pay more over a shorter quantity of time it’s simple economics really. Due to their mathematically shorter lifespans, men have a tendency to cover more for final expense insurance than women.
This can be one of the rationales that lots of people strongly counsel that you take out burial insurance early on. A lifetime of almost unnoticeably small payments is far better than trying to make fewer bigger payments when you’re frequently relying on a pension for income.

Your health also plays a large part in your premiums. If you have a history of serious health problems, your premium will likely be higher. It is useful to understand that insurance companies that are different have various standards. Therefore, if you do have health problems, it is worth it to look around.
